Intracellular Receptors
Proteins located inside the cell that bind to certain substances and initiate a specific cellular response.
First Messenger
A signaling molecule that binds to a receptor on the cell surface, initiating a signal transduction process that leads to the formation of an intracellular second messenger.
Ion Channel
An ion channel is a protein structure embedded in cell membranes that allows ions to pass through the membrane selectively.
Ligand
A molecule that binds specifically to another molecule, usually a larger one, in a reversible manner.
